Onboarding note for the Ledgerpane admin table: bulk edits are applied through the batcher service, not directly against the database. Select rows, choose an action, and the batcher stages changes in a pending set you can review before commit. Edits over 500 rows require a second approver — this is enforced server-side, so don't try to chunk around it. To run the batcher locally you need the staging write credential, which goes in your .env as the next line.

secret setting of bahip-kagag: RELAY_SECRET3=c83

Subject: On-call handover — ParityPeek

Welcome to the rotation. ParityPeek compares our published hotel rates against partner feeds every twenty minutes. Most pages are false alarms caused by currency rounding, so check the tolerance config before escalating. Review any diffs flagged overnight and annotate them in the tracker. The triage dashboard is linked below.

runbook for kagap-tawep: https://jira.tolvaqcorp.corp/browse/job/view/7f34cad8e4ed

## Deployment

The Lanternfill scheduler runs nightly backfills for the Driftbasin warehouse. Deploy only from a tagged release; the pipeline rejects untagged builds. After deploying, verify the scheduler registers all backfill jobs by checking the admin panel's job roster — missing entries usually mean a bad cron expression. Never run two scheduler instances against the same queue, as duplicate backfills corrupt partition markers. Before your first deploy, confirm the environment matches the configuration values shown below.

config for bagep-kageg:
ULADOR_LOG_LEVEL=warn
ULADOR_METRICS_HOST=metrics.ulador.tolvaqcorp.corp
ULADOR_POOL_SIZE=32

Capacity note for TerraScout offline mode: each surveyor device caches map tiles, form schemas, and pending submissions locally. Support should expect storage complaints when crews exceed roughly two weeks offline. Sync backlog grows linearly with photo attachments, so the queue ceiling is the usual culprit behind stuck uploads. The limits we currently ship, which you can quote to field teams, are the following.

constants for bagaf-hadup:
QUOTAS = {
    "quenael": 1,
    "ralwyn": 1,
    "oliath": 2,
    "ulaael": 2,
}